Distribution Software: One Click Equals Two Hours

Company Website

Time is money. For every minute your customer service rep is pulling customer files to answer a delivery question, you are losing money. Ditto for the time to process vendor rebates, calculate special pricing allowances, and run mid-month financial statements.

Imagine a world in which one click of the mouse equals one, two or three hours of time. With today's sophisticated electronic integration, you don't need to imagine. It's available for any size distributorship, with the initial investment dwarfing the return on investment.

One software system, DDI System, is designed specifically for the small- to medium-sized distributor.

"The DDI System provides us real-time customer service … no waiting for paperwork to be pulled or manually adjusted," says David Kawut, CEO of Supply King Inc. in Neptune City, N.J. "In addition to real-time information, our customer service has 'fast-key' access to the customer's complete profile, credit and purchase history."

For customers, that means immediate service and fast answers to their questions. For the company, that means saving hours of time and keeping customers satisfied.

"For each minute that we can save a distributor in manual paperwork, it's a minute they can use to constructively increase their profitability," says Adam Waller, president of DDI System LLC. "There are many nuances of the jan/san industry, such as customized pricing for different customers, that our software package addresses and provides the extra time-saving steps."

Reports to Grow Your Business
The right software package can provide vital information to grow your business. In seconds, the DDI System generates reports that profiles customers, evaluates sales force performance and analyzes product viability. Reports also pinpoint which products are selling the best, which vendor provides the best profit margins, and which products are becoming dead-weight.

Remote Log-in.
The DDI System also enables sales people to remotely log-on to the company system and download customer information before they make a sales call. In the midst of a call, they can bring up the most current pricing (even if it changed just an hour before) and place orders.

Automated Vendor Rebate
The right package also streamlines the accounting department.
"The DDI System calculates our vendor rebates in just one day, versus two to three days if we did it manually," says Ann Marie Nichols, general manager at Supply King Inc. "With 10 vendors on rebate programs, it's a significant time savings."


EDI – Electronic Data Integration
The future of profitability in the jan/san industry lies in the ability to electronically exchange information between vendor and distributor. Some companies are leading the way in implementing an EDI program, and others are just starting to gear up for this next wave of technology. The writing is on the wall — companies need to become EDI proficient or they will struggle to keep their competitive edge with pricing and timely delivery from manufacturers.
Supply King has started to venture into EDI technology with the current DDI System by implementing exchange of information from its main office to satellite locations, whether it is a salesperson or an accounts receivable staffer working out of her home.
"My mother has been handling our accounts receivable for several years," explains Bruce Crystal, COO of Supply King, Inc. "With the DDI System, she opens up her desktop at home and just clicks on the DDi icon. From there, she can access the full customer profile so when she calls on past-due accounts, she is fully informed and can answer any questions they have.
"With our addition of the signature capture program, which electronically captures the delivery signature, she can access, view and forward delivery slips, invoices and any additional paperwork within minutes, all from the comfort of her home office.”
260 Saved Hours
"In fact, with the capture program upgrade, the DDI System saves us about 260 hours a year in our post-delivery paperwork. Instead of pushing paper, our staff can refocus their time on other tasks, such as solicitation," Crystal adds.
